How Is Digital Stenciling Changing Machine Precision?
The transfers of stencils made by digital stenciling tools are more precise and clean. Combined with the current tattoo machines, this accuracy allows an artist to work in line with specifications, particularly when working with thin lines or models. Improved stencils minimize the number of times a machine has to pass, meaning that machines are more productive and that skin trauma is minimized.
Does AI Influence How Artists Adjust Machine Settings?
Yes. AI-powered previews guide the artist to predict the line weight, density of shading, and contrast. Having a better understanding of expectations, artists can set voltage, stroke length, and depth of the needle more precisely prior to the start of the process. This will result in the more constant use of machines and a reduction in the number of mid-session changes.
